Starting a weight loss journey often involves battling persistent hunger pangs throughout the day.


Understanding the factors contributing to hunger is key to finding effective solutions.


Hunger can be triggered by various factors, including sudden calorie drops, inadequate food intake, and even dehydration. Hormonal imbalances are the primary culprits behind incessant hunger on a diet.


Your body relies on hormones to relay hunger and satiety signals to the brain. When these hormones are out of sync, feelings of hunger can become overwhelming.

To combat this, consider a simple yet powerful strategy: increase your protein consumption.


Research suggests that prioritizing protein in your diet over carbohydrates and fats can help regulate appetite and reduce hunger cues.


This shift can promote more stable blood sugar levels, leading to decreased cravings.


Additionally, protein plays a crucial role in balancing hunger and satiety hormones in the body. By incorporating more protein-rich foods into your meals, you can enhance feelings of fullness and satisfaction, ultimately curbing excessive hunger.


If you find yourself constantly battling hunger at the onset of a diet, boosting your protein intake may be the key to achieving greater meal satisfaction and appetite control.
